1. TEKS
1.b (6) Force, motion, and energy. The student knows that
force, motion, and energy are related and are a part of everyday life. The student is expected to: (B) predict and describe
how a magnet can be used to push or pull an object.

5. Input
How can we make things move? Color picture of examples showing objects that are able to move
other objects. Discussion after: what causes these objects to move other objects?
Modeling
Model lab station as whole group. Divide into groups by group clock.
Model station changing with music and what is done at each station.
Guided Practice/monitoring
Perform lab with 3 stations. Stations should be centered around teacher(s) for complete student access to teacher.
Teacher ensures formative assessment and feedback as students complete station cards and check off with each other
and then teacher. One station is a computer interactive to serve as technological aspect of lesson.
